Hauler seamlessly bends and blends roots, rock, and traditional Cape Breton Celtic music together into a hearty homemade soup that can dynamically have you hanging off every lyric—or knock you flat on your arse. The contemporary Cape Breton Celtic trio features multi-instrumentalist singer and songwriters Mike LeLievre and Steven MacDougall (Slowcoaster) teamed up with versatile Cape Breton fiddler Colin Grant. Enjoy an evening of music from Hauler with special opening sets from Billie Yvette and Mae River.
